The main activities at Helios Hospital Munich West
Vascular Surgery
The vascular surgery department at Helios München West is one of the leaders in Germany. In 2018, 331 vascular surgeries were performed with zero mortality, which confirms the high level of safety and effectiveness of treatment. The vascular surgeons perform complex endovascular interventions, including balloon angioplasty and stenting. The department’s doctors use minimally invasive methods to treat varicose veins, aneurysms, gangrene, and chronic vascular diseases.
Oncological Treatment
Helios Hospital Munich West has certified centers for the treatment of colorectal cancer and breast cancer. Diagnostic methods include CT, MRI, PET-CT, and endoscopy with biopsy. Cancer treatment involves advanced technologists such as:
- hyperthermic intraperitoneal chemotherapy (HIPEC);
- intraoperative electron beam radiotherapy (IOERT);
- brachytherapy;
- thermal ablation;
- radiofrequency ablation of tumors.
For pancreatic cancer, the hospital uses the NanoKnife technology (nano-ablation), which ensures the targeted destruction of tumor cells without damaging surrounding tissue.
Orthopedics and Joint Replacement
The Joint Replacement Center is equipped with the Mako robotic system for high-precision implantation of knee and hip joint prostheses. Minimally invasive techniques reduce surgical trauma and accelerate recovery. The Endoactivity-Parcours rehabilitation program provides step-by-step therapy focused on restoring joint mobility and strength. Modern implants with improved biocompatible coatings are used.
Diagnostics and Laboratory Testing
Helios Hospital Munich West has an in-house laboratory that performs a wide range of tests, including:
- general and biochemical blood tests;
- microbiological testing;
- gastric juice and gut microbiome testing.
For internal organs imaging, the hospital uses computed tomography (CT), mag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), ultrasound diagnostics, and digital X-ray diagnostics.
Technical Equipment and Medical Staff
The hospital is equipped with hybrid operating rooms, robotic systems, and telemedicine technology. The team consists of approximately 950 employees, including 78 physicians, 4 professors and 8 associate professors. The head of the vascular surgery department is MD Reza Ghotbi, a recognized expert with international experience.
